Love, love, love. Started with a tasting in the bottle ship half and ended with a few cocktails on the bar side. As on my last visit, extra friendly, knowledgeable staff. It was busy, but I got multiple check ins on how I was doing, was my drink to my liking, etc. On the tasting side, the pourer knew spirits well, educated me on what Corsair does with their spirits and we swapped stories of our favorite whiskies, gins and cocktails. I do my share of hunting for great spirits, and I love supporting places like Corsair. While I'll buy them in the liquor store, both times I've been here I've been able to get bottles you could only get in the bottle shop. If you visit, you will be glad you did. (Yes, that's a Wildfire. They don't make it anymore, but a distributor went out of business and returned a pallet. Lucky me!)

Our group of 8 did a tasting for $10/pp, and the spirits themselves were good. However, the bartender we had was overly relaxed (even for a bartender). He was extremely foul-mouthed, and barely told us anything at all about any of the alcohol he was pouring us. When we wanted to drink the absinthe shot without the addition of water, we were scolded.This distillery is well off the beaten path in relation to the other distilleries around, which is quite nice if you're looking to get away from the rowdy Broadway St crowds. The bar behind the tasting room had good beers and cocktails. As far as distillery experiences and tastings go, this did not meet our expectations.
